Let me start by saying that we are happy with the way year '27 has begun. Q1 has given us a great start not just in terms of business growth, but also in terms of progress we are making in building a stronger, more diversified and technology-driven logistic business. Revenue grow 6% on year in Q1 while PAT grow by nearly 30% for us. Important point is that profitability has grown much faster than revenue. This tell us that the work we have been doing on execution, asset utilization and operational efficiency is beginning to show results. But I would like to look beyond the numbers today. Our focus for year '27 is very clear: grow the business by sweating of the assets, deepen customer relationships and build new growth engines. During the quarter, we have secured a long-term contract from Haldiram, Nagpur for the deployment of 100 dedicated vehicles. This is an important addition to our FMCG business and strengthen our presence across western, southern and key eastern market including Odisha, Bihar and Jharkhand. Most importantly, it demonstrate that confidence that large customer are placing in AVG to manage their logistic requirement at scale. We also see significant opportunity to grow our business with existing customers. Today, customers are increasingly looking for a logistic partner who can manage multiple parts of their supply chain rather than simply provide transportation. This play directly to our strength. We are using real-time vehicle tracking and our in-house technology solutions to give customer better visibility, better control and more flexibility. For us, technology is not just about the adding another feature to our service, it is about improving the way we operate and making our business more scalable. Page 2 of 11 AVG Logistics Limited August 26, 2026 At that same time, we are deliberately building a new business around our core logistic platform. Liquid logistics is one such opportunity. We entered this strength because we see strong demand and relatively limited organized competition. We have already started building capabilities to intend the scale this business meaningfully over the coming years. Customers are increasing for cleaner transportation solution. We are responding through CNG, LNG and electric vehicle. During Q1, we also entered into a joint venture with Baidyanath Group to accelerate LNG powered transportation across sectors such as steel, metal and cement. We see this as a long-term opportunity, not just a sustainability initiative. As a customer move towards cleaner supply chain, we believe AVG can play an important role in helping them make that transition. India's logistics sector is undergoing a structural transformation. Manufacturing is growing, consumption is increasing, e-commerce continue to expand, supply chain are becoming more organized, and the government is investing heavily in infrastructure and multimodal connectivity. Initiative such as PM Gati Shakti and National Logistics Policy along with the development for freight corridors and logistic infrastructure are creating a much larger opportunity for organized logistic companies. Recently, government has also started the DFC, Dedicated Freight Corridor where the operation has already started by us through Dedicated Freight Corridor organization. We have built a pan-India network, a diversified customer base, more than 3,000 owned and hired vehicles, over 70 branches, and more than 7.4 lakh square feet of warehousing capacity. We are now adding technology, specialized logistics, and alternative fuel capability to this platform. This give us multiple levers for growth. As we said in our previous earning call, our objective for '27 is to deliver approximately 15% to 20% growth. We remain confident in this objective, supported by our existing customer base, new customer pipeline, and expansion into a new business segment. We also remain conscious that growth has to be responsible growth. Our focus is on deploying capital against real customer opportunities, improving the productivity of our existing assets, and maintaining operational discipline. We want very new investment to strengthen our ability to serve customer and create long-term value. We have also continued to balance growth investment with shareholder return with the Board declaring a dividend of Rupee 1.20 per equity share for '26. As we look ahead, our message is simple: the opportunity in Indian logistics is large and AVG is building the capability to capture a larger share of it. We have a healthy pipeline, new customer opportunity, new business segment, and a clear strategy for the years ahead. We remain optimistic about the road ahead and confident in our ability to deliver consistent growth and create long-term value for our all stakeholders. I will take you through the key financial performance for Q1 FY27, followed by our operating performance, cost management, balance sheet and capital allocation. Let me start with the headline numbers. We reported revenue from operations of INR132.48 crores in Q1 FY27, compared with INR125.02 crores in Q1 FY26, representing a year-on-year growth of 5.97%. What is particularly encouraging is the improvement in profitability. PBT increased 24.42% year-on- year to INR8.71 crores, while PAT increased 29.98% to INR6.46 crores.
